MySQL 数据库一个汉字诠释其强悍之处(mysql 一个汉字)
随着现代信息技术的快速发展,数据库技术也在不断壮大。其中,MySQL数据库凭借其强大的功能和可靠的性能,一直受到大家的好评。MySQL是一个开源的数据库系统,具有稳定性、安全性、高效性、易用性等诸多优点。下面,本文将从各个方面来详细阐述MySQL数据库的强悍之处。
一、强大的SQL语言支持
SQL语言是关系型数据库的标准语言,MySQL数据库对SQL语言提供全面的支持。MySQL支持的SQL语句包括查询数据、修改数据、删除数据、新增数据等。而且,MySQL支持事务操作和索引优化等特性,这些特性使得MySQL数据库可以完成更复杂的操作。
示例代码:
查询:
SELECT * FROM user WHERE age > 18;
INSERT:
INSERT INTO user(name, age) VALUES(“Lucy”, 21);
二、高效的性能表现
MySQL运作速度快,不仅支持索引优化,而且还支持内存缓存技术,能够使效率得到进一步提升。MySQL是多线程服务器,具有高并发、低延迟的特点。而且,MySQL还支持分布式集群,多机协同完成数据存储和读取,提供更高效稳定的服务。
示例代码:
创建索引:
CREATE INDEX name_index ON user(name);
三、高安全性
MySQL提供多层次的安全机制,例如账户权限、独占模式、SSL加密等机制。MySQL对数据的安全处理也非常细致,支持数据备份、数据恢复、数据加密等功能,保证数据的完整性和安全性。
示例代码:
账户权限:
GRANT SELECT, INSERT, UPDATE, DELETE ON mydb.* TO ‘user’@‘127.0.0.1’ IDENTIFIED BY ‘password’;
四、易用性
MySQL具有易学易用的特点,用户可以很快地上手并掌握其基本操作。MySQL还提供了丰富的API接口,支持各种编程语言,例如C++、Java、Python等,开发人员可以使用这些API开发出各种应用程序。
示例代码:
Python数据库连接:
import pymysql
db = pymysql.connect(host=”localhost”, user=”root”, password=”123456″, database=”test”)
cursor = db.cursor()
cursor.execute(“SELECT * FROM user”)
result = cursor.fetchall()
for row in result:
print(row)
db.close()
综上所述,MySQL数据库强大、可靠、高效、安全、易用的特性让它成为了现代信息技术领域中不可或缺的一部分。这里只是简单展示了MySQL的一些功能,MySQL还有很多有趣的特性等待开发人员去发掘。因此,我们可以说,MySQL真正的强悍之处在于其开放的思想,提供了极佳的开发平台,为数据处理领域的进一步发展提供了强有力的支持。